About Astray
You tilt and roll a ball through twisting 3D corridors, coaxing it toward the exit while the walls close in around you. Every maze is procedurally generated, so no two runs look the same — the moment you think you've memorized a pattern, the geometry reshuffles and catches you off guard.
Built with WebGL, Astray runs entirely in the browser with smooth, real-time 3D rendering and no installation required. How to use
• Use ARROW KEYS or WASD to roll the ball through the maze • Navigate from your starting position to the exit at the bottom-right corner of the maze • The camera follows your ball automatically as you move • Complete each level to advance to a larger, more challenging maze • Your ball has realistic physics - it will bounce off walls and maintain momentum • Press 'I' to toggle these instructions on/off during play • The game starts at Level 1 and progressively increases difficulty with each completed maze • Look for the opening in the maze walls to find your way to the exit
